Drum Stick Techniques methods
Mastering drum stick techniques is essential for any drummer. Novices should focus on improving a solid hold and honing basic rudiments like the single stroke roll and double stroke roll. As you advance, experiment with diverse stick orientations to create distinct sounds and nuances.
- Keep in mind that proper hand position is crucial for comfort and control.
- Explore using different stick weights and materials to find what works best for you.
- Pay attention to the sound you're creating and modify your technique accordingly.
